[Bug 225990] New: to-do list, trying to add existing recurring to-do's as sub-to to another to-do to organize list better

Jonathan Cain philotech at gmail.com
Tue Feb 9 03:25:05 GMT 2010


https://bugs.kde.org/show_bug.cgi?id=225990

           Summary: to-do list, trying to add existing recurring to-do's
                    as sub-to to another to-do to organize list better
           Product: kontact
           Version: unspecified
          Platform: Unlisted Binaries
        OS/Version: Linux
            Status: UNCONFIRMED
          Severity: crash
          Priority: NOR
         Component: general
        AssignedTo: kdepim-bugs at kde.org
        ReportedBy: philotech at gmail.com


Application that crashed: kontact
Version of the application: 4.3.5
KDE Version: 4.3.5 (KDE 4.3.5)
Qt Version: 4.5.2
Operating System: Linux 2.6.31-20-generic x86_64
Distribution: Ubuntu 9.10

What I was doing when the application crashed:
1.  Start Kontact
2.  Switch to To-Do list.  There should already me 10-20 to-dos  and a bunch of
completed ones
3.  The order they are in is somewhat random and completed to-dos are often
above other uncompleted to-dos
4.  Search for a general named to-do or create one that can be a subject name
for a series of sub-tos that are related.
5.  Try to move an existing sub-to-do that is uncomplete or completed to the
subject to-do to organzie
6.  Kontact crashes every time.

 -- Backtrace:
Application: Kontact (kontact), signal: Segmentation fault
The current source language is "auto; currently c".
[KCrash Handler]
#5  0x00007fab98f66170 in QListData::size (this=0x27b01a0, parent=...) at
/usr/include/qt4/QtCore/qlist.h:87
#6  QList<KOTodoModel::TodoTreeNode*>::count (this=0x27b01a0, parent=...) at
/usr/include/qt4/QtCore/qlist.h:250
#7  KOTodoModel::TodoTreeNode::childrenCount (this=0x27b01a0, parent=...) at
../../korganizer/views/todoview/kotodomodel.cpp:161
#8  KOTodoModel::rowCount (this=0x27b01a0, parent=...) at
../../korganizer/views/todoview/kotodomodel.cpp:648
#9  0x00007fab98f65fdc in KOTodoModel::index (this=0x27b01a0, row=1, column=0,
parent=...) at ../../korganizer/views/todoview/kotodomodel.cpp:609
#10 0x00007fabb9e0ee96 in void QAlgorithmsPrivate::qMerge<int*, int const,
QSortFilterProxyModelLessThan>(int*, int*, int*, int const&,
QSortFilterProxyModelLessThan) () from /usr/lib/libQtGui.so.4
#11 0x00007fabb9e0f07c in void QAlgorithmsPrivate::qStableSortHelper<int*, int,
QSortFilterProxyModelLessThan>(int*, int*, int const&,
QSortFilterProxyModelLessThan) () from /usr/lib/libQtGui.so.4
#12 0x00007fabb9e05ad1 in qStableSort<int*, QSortFilterProxyModelLessThan>
(this=<value optimized out>, source_rows=..., source_parent=<value optimized
out>)
    at ../../include/QtCore/../../src/corelib/tools/qalgorithms.h:229
#13 QSortFilterProxyModelPrivate::sort_source_rows (this=<value optimized out>,
source_rows=..., source_parent=<value optimized out>) at
itemviews/qsortfilterproxymodel.cpp:397
#14 0x00007fabb9e07251 in QSortFilterProxyModelPrivate::sort (this=0x279d2e0)
at itemviews/qsortfilterproxymodel.cpp:362
#15 0x00007fabb9dc9085 in QTreeView::qt_metacall (this=0x27a9c50,
_c=QMetaObject::InvokeMetaMethod, _id=<value optimized out>, _a=0x7fff895e3390)
at .moc/release-shared/moc_qtreeview.cpp:153
#16 0x00007fab98f6eba0 in KOTodoViewView::qt_metacall (this=0x27b01a0,
_c=2304651320, _id=41547009, _a=0x0) at ./kotodoviewview.moc:62
#17 0x00007fabb8f9dddc in QMetaObject::activate (sender=0x27ba570,
from_signal_index=<value optimized out>, to_signal_index=<value optimized out>,
argv=0x0) at kernel/qobject.cpp:3113
#18 0x00007fabb9d8b77f in QHeaderView::sortIndicatorChanged (this=0x27b01a0,
_t1=0, _t2=Qt::AscendingOrder) at .moc/release-shared/moc_qheaderview.cpp:278
#19 0x00007fabb9d96c08 in QHeaderView::mouseReleaseEvent (this=0x27ba570,
e=<value optimized out>) at itemviews/qheaderview.cpp:2286
#20 0x00007fabb98fb9c0 in QWidget::event (this=0x27ba570, event=0x7fff895e3f30)
at kernel/qwidget.cpp:7549
#21 0x00007fabb9c572a6 in QFrame::event (this=0x27ba570, e=0x7fff895e3f30) at
widgets/qframe.cpp:559
#22 0x00007fabb9d8a21b in QAbstractItemView::viewportEvent (this=0x27ba570,
event=0x7fff895e3f30) at itemviews/qabstractitemview.cpp:1476
#23 0x00007fabb9d9371b in QHeaderView::viewportEvent (this=0x27ba570,
e=0x7fff895e3f30) at itemviews/qheaderview.cpp:2400
#24 0x00007fabb8f87f47 in
QCoreApplicationPrivate::sendThroughObjectEventFilters (this=<value optimized
out>, receiver=0x27ba540, event=0x7fff895e3f30) at
kernel/qcoreapplication.cpp:726
#25 0x00007fabb98acecc in QApplicationPrivate::notify_helper (this=0x15a9e90,
receiver=0x27ba540, e=0x7fff895e3f30) at kernel/qapplication.cpp:4052
#26 0x00007fabb98b4011 in QApplication::notify (this=<value optimized out>,
receiver=0x27ba540, e=0x7fff895e3f30) at kernel/qapplication.cpp:3758
#27 0x00007fabba4e3f46 in KApplication::notify (this=0x7fff895e5e50,
receiver=0x27ba540, event=0x7fff895e3f30) at
../../kdeui/kernel/kapplication.cpp:302
#28 0x00007fabb8f88c2c in QCoreApplication::notifyInternal
(this=0x7fff895e5e50, receiver=0x27ba540, event=0x7fff895e3f30) at
kernel/qcoreapplication.cpp:610
#29 0x00007fabb98b38e0 in QCoreApplication::sendSpontaneousEvent
(receiver=0x27ba540, event=0x7fff895e3f30, alienWidget=0x27ba540,
nativeWidget=0x16cbe20, buttonDown=<value optimized out>, 
    lastMouseReceiver=<value optimized out>) at
../../include/QtCore/../../src/corelib/kernel/qcoreapplication.h:216
#30 QApplicationPrivate::sendMouseEvent (receiver=0x27ba540,
event=0x7fff895e3f30, alienWidget=0x27ba540, nativeWidget=0x16cbe20,
buttonDown=<value optimized out>, 
    lastMouseReceiver=<value optimized out>) at kernel/qapplication.cpp:2924
#31 0x00007fabb9919a0e in QETWidget::translateMouseEvent (this=0x16cbe20,
event=<value optimized out>) at kernel/qapplication_x11.cpp:4409
#32 0x00007fabb9918aa9 in QApplication::x11ProcessEvent (this=<value optimized
out>, event=0x7fff895e5a60) at kernel/qapplication_x11.cpp:3550
#33 0x00007fabb9941d0c in x11EventSourceDispatch (s=<value optimized out>,
callback=<value optimized out>, user_data=<value optimized out>) at
kernel/qguieventdispatcher_glib.cpp:146
#34 0x00007fabb2800bce in g_main_context_dispatch () from /lib/libglib-2.0.so.0
#35 0x00007fabb2804598 in ?? () from /lib/libglib-2.0.so.0
#36 0x00007fabb28046c0 in g_main_context_iteration () from
/lib/libglib-2.0.so.0
#37 0x00007fabb8fb11a6 in QEventDispatcherGlib::processEvents (this=0x156acb0,
flags=<value optimized out>) at kernel/qeventdispatcher_glib.cpp:327
#38 0x00007fabb99414be in QGuiEventDispatcherGlib::processEvents
(this=0x27b01a0, flags=<value optimized out>) at
kernel/qguieventdispatcher_glib.cpp:202
#39 0x00007fabb8f87532 in QEventLoop::processEvents (this=<value optimized
out>, flags=) at kernel/qeventloop.cpp:149
#40 0x00007fabb8f87904 in QEventLoop::exec (this=0x7fff895e5d90, flags=) at
kernel/qeventloop.cpp:201
#41 0x00007fabb8f89ab9 in QCoreApplication::exec () at
kernel/qcoreapplication.cpp:888
#42 0x0000000000403f47 in main (argc=<value optimized out>, argv=<value
optimized out>) at ../../../kontact/src/main.cpp:218

Reported using DrKonqi

-- 
Configure bugmail: https://bugs.kde.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.



More information about the Kdepim-bugs mailing list